PASTA WITH ROASTED RED PEPPERS AND GOAT CHEESE

Years ago, I stayed with an Italian friend in Bologna who worked long hours at his job. By the time he got home, he was hungry, so he'd start water boiling and cast about his tiny kitchen to see what he could use for dinner. Then, to my fascination, he'd whip up a delicious pasta sauce from almost nothing: a few anchovies and some walnuts, or a can of tuna and another of beans. Yesterday's bread became today's bread crumbs, browned in olive oil with garlic and tossed with spaghetti, olives, capers and jarred tomato purée. I try to keep a jar of roasted peppers handy at all times. They're useful for panini, pizzas and especially pastas like this one. Spanish piquillo peppers are particularly sweet, but bell peppers will do as well. If you have basil, it's delicious in this dish - but not required.

Steps:

  • Bring a large pot of water to a boil. Meanwhile, heat the olive oil over medium heat in a large, heavy skillet. Add the garlic. Cook, stirring, until fragrant, about 30 seconds. Add the sliced roasted peppers, and stir together for about a minute until well infused with the oil and garlic. Season with salt and pepper, and stir in the basil (if using) and goat cheese. Remove from the heat.
  • When the water comes to a boil, salt generously and add the pasta. Cook until al dente - firm to the bite - following the recommendations on the package. Ladle about 1/2 cup of the pasta cooking water into the frying pan, and stir well so that the goat cheese begins to melt. Drain the pasta, and toss immediately with the pepper mixture in the pan. Serve.

FENNEL WITH SHALLOTS, ROSEMARY AND GOAT CHEESE

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 450°F. Butter 13 x 9 x 2-inch broilerproof baking dish. Sprinkle shallots, rosemary and garlic over bottom of prepared dish. Cook fennel in boiling salted water until crisp-tender, about 12 minutes. Using slotted spoon, transfer fennel, cut side up, to prepared dish. Pour wine over fennel. Dot with butter. Sprinkle with salt and pepper.
  • Bake fennel uncovered until tender, basting occasionally with wine and turning fennel over halfway through baking, about 30 minutes. (Can be made 1 day ahead. Cover; chill. Rewarm, uncovered, in 350°F oven for about 15 minutes before continuing.)
  • Preheat broiler. Turn fennel cut side up. Sprinkle goat cheese over fennel. Broil until cheese melts and begins to brown, watching closely to avoid burning, about 6 minutes.
  • Transfer fennel to platter. Season wine mixture in baking dish to taste with salt and pepper; spoon over fennel. Garnish platter with reserved fennel fronds and serve immediately.

1/4 cup chopped shallots
1 tablespoon chopped fresh rosemary
1 tablespoon chopped garlic
6 small fennel bulbs, trimmed, halved lengthwise, fronds reserved for garnish
2 cups dry white wine
6 tablespoons (3/4 stick) butter, cut into pieces
6 ounces soft fresh goat cheese (such as Montrachet), crumbled

MARINATED GOAT CHEESE

These are especially nice to have on hand for adding to salads and quick toasted open-faced sandwiches. Place a round on a piece of bread, pop it in a toaster oven and toast 3 to 4 minutes.

Steps:

  • Place the peppercorns, garlic cloves and bay leaves in a clean, sterilized wide-mouthed jar. Pour in a film of olive oil.
  • Cut the goat cheese into rounds 1/2 inch thick (I get neat rounds using unflavored dental floss to cut through the cheese). Place one round in the jar and drizzle on some olive oil. Stack the remaining rounds, drizzling oil onto each round before topping with the next. Add the thyme and rosemary sprigs to the jar and pour in olive oil to cover the goat cheese rounds completely. Cover the jar and leave at room temperature for several hours, then refrigerate.

GOAT CHEESE MARINATED IN ROSEMARY, FENNEL, AND HOT RED PEPPER

Steps:

  • In a 1-pint jar with a tight-fitting lid combine the cheese with the fennel seeds, the red pepper flakes, the rosemary, and the lemon zest, pour enough of the oil over the mixture to cover the cheese completely, and let the cheese marinate, covered, and chilled, for at least 1 week and up to 4 weeks. Let the mixture come to room temperature before serving.

a 1/2-pound log of mild goat cheese, such as Montrachet, cut crosswise into 4 pieces, or four 2-ounce crottins
1 tablespoon fennel seeds, crushed
1 teaspoon crushed dried hot red pepper flakes
6 to 8 rosemary sprigs
the zest of 1 lemon, removed with a vegetable peeler
1 to 1 1/2 cups olive oil
